Add a message asking to enable usage ping feature to administrators
Resources
PM @regisF | UX @hazelyang
Description
We want to add the EE usage ping feature to CE (https://gitlab.com/gitlab-org/gitlab-ce/issues/23361). Before an instance sends the usage ping, we need to ask for permissions to send it to the administrators.
This message is only shown for CE installations.
Proposal
- UX: We need to add a message at the top of the user interface, visible only to the administrators, presenting the usage ping and asking to use it: YES/NO + learn more link. You can take inspiration from https://gitlab.com/gitlab-org/gitlab-ce/issues/23361#note_20033830
- UX: Learn more should redirect to the documentation
- Once the answer is recorded (whatever the answer), we shall never display this bar again.
- This message appears in the administration area: this is where the administrators who just upgraded the instance will likely go to check if the version has changed.
The message is as follow:
To help improve GitLab Community Edition, you can anonymously send usage
statistics to the team. The resulting data play a key role in deciding what to focus on.
We don't collect any private information. You can see the exact payload [here]().
YES/NO